“Lyubov called me and said that she was detained by uniformed officers,” the lawyer told RIA Novosti.

The reasons for the detention have not yet been reported.

Earlier, the magistrate's court passed a verdict against Sobol in the case of illegal entry into someone else's apartment.

She was given a probationary year of correctional labor.

Until recently, Sobol was under house arrest in a case of violation of sanitary and epidemiological standards at an uncoordinated rally.

Later, she was replaced by a preventive measure with a ban on certain actions.
